> JDO-596 requests an upgrade to Maven2.  At this point, I would recommend that 
> we evaluate some other solutions (listed in no particular order):
> * Maven2
> * Ant+Ivy
> * Gant+Ivy
> * Gradle
> We could potentially reap time savings by using a build & test tool that 
> leverages dynamic languages like Groovy in the TCK.
